Transaction 2aef759936bcd6a93690c110e77af6a85d3a007e15a91e69f3c07d56e76c1484
3 Input
2 Outputs
- 2aef759936bcd6a93690c110e77af6a85d3a007e15a91e69f3c07d56e76c1484:0
- 2aef759936bcd6a93690c110e77af6a85d3a007e15a91e69f3c07d56e76c1484:1
value 10523606
address 3KR3wxG24b71m6PV1Exe6vk7yLmHYgqSbe
value 10445949
address 3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w